Step into the perfect venue for a tasty breakfast, leisurely lunch (take it away or stay) or some afternoon tea with a scone.
We provide table service or food to go if you need to get back to work, and are open from 7.30am to make you your first coffee of the day on the way to work. We are also open on Saturdays with breakfast being served all day,so if you are ambling around or shopping in the City Centre and in need of some brunch then pop into Wander.
If you are organising a meeting we can deliver lunch to your office. Check out our corporate catering menus for further details.
So if you want good food, great coffee and cheery staff we’re the place for you. We’ll welcome you back time after time and you’ll become a new regular before long!
